Output bdd864d51fe31e8310023aee604ee42d6ff44c73a91b4ebbcda5cfd2d835f2e4:554

value
12796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443e421d444ecfb3c6c6ea44d47e30fd69b9d09f OP_EQUAL
address
37urTNHsASfoCZfiPhRNhgnDL1aC9RzT78
transaction
bdd864d51fe31e8310023aee604ee42d6ff44c73a91b4ebbcda5cfd2d835f2e4
spent
true